Horrified Daughter Discovered Her Mother, 64, Had Hidden Three of Her Stillborn Baby Daughters in Her Wardrobe and Another in a Bag Beside Her Bed for 20 YEARS

  • Bernadette Quirk wrapped three in newspaper kept in bin with air freshener
  • Remains of babies were found in 2009 by her daughter who contacted police.
  • Police believe she was drinking and having casual sex after marriage broke up
  • Quirk was spared jail at UK Liverpool Crown Court in 2010 but died in February 2019
Daily Mail UK, 11 APR 2019....






Bernadette Quirk, pictured outside Liverpool Crown Court in 2010, wrapped three of the babies in newspaper and rags in a plastic bin...





The remains of the babies were found in 2009 by her daughter Joanne Lee, pictured recently...


A mother who hid three of her stillborn baby daughters in her wardrobe and another in a bag beside her bed for 20 years has died aged 64.

Bernadette Quirk, of St Helens, Merseyside, wrapped three of the babies in newspaper and rags kept in a small plastic bin with an air freshener.

The remains of the babies – whom she gave birth to between 1985 and 1995 - were found in 2009 by her daughter Joanne Lee, who contacted police.

Each of the babies had a different father, and police believe they were born when she was drinking and having casual sex after her marriage broke up in the 1980s.

Quirk was spared jail at Liverpool Crown Court in December 2010 after admitting four counts of concealing births. She died in February.

Ms Lee, 47, who is a mother-of-three and grandmother-of-four, has now written of the harrowing story in a book called Silent Sisters, published on April 18.

She told the Liverpool Echo: 'I couldn't stand the woman - and what she put us all through. But I wouldn't go back and change any of it. It's made me a better mother and person.'

Ms Lee was 26 in May 1998 when her sister Cath, then 16, told her that Quirk had put the remains of a baby in the wardrobe.

Without telling authorities, she then helped her mother bury the baby in the family grave, where her own son John had been legally buried.

Ms Lee added: 'If I had known then what I know now I would have gone to the police there and then.

'I knew I was doing wrong and I could have gone to jail but I think a lot of it was to do with me losing my own child, and I felt sorry for her. I thought she was grieving.'

She also told how her mother had mental health issues, and used to claim Freddie Mercury had given her ballet lessons and she had 'got off' with Michael Jackson.





Quirk fell into a 'chaotic and dysfunctional' lifestyle after the break-up of her marriage


At Liverpool Crown Court in 2010, prosecutor Anya Horwood told how Quirk had fallen into a 'chaotic and dysfunctional' lifestyle following the break-up of her second marriage.

She said: 'The defendant's heavy drinking significantly impaired her ability to look after her children, her family and herself. She had a number of sexual relationships during this period.'

There was no explanation about why Quirk kept the remains with her - moving home several times in the intervening years.

At the end of July 2009, Quirk's daughter discovered the remains of one baby in her mother's wardrobe at her house.

Police then searched the property and Quirk directed them to the remains of two more infants, also wrapped up in the bedroom.






Ms Lee has written about the harrowing story in a book called Silent Sisters, out on April 18







The defendant told detectives she gave birth to the four babies at her previous home in St Helens, and they were all stillborn.


Forensic tests suggested they had congenital disorders and Quirk was charged with concealing birth contrary to the Offences Against the Person Act 1861.

Ian Morris, defending, said Quirk embarked on a series of inappropriate relationships following the breakdown of her marriage.

He said she hid the pregnancies because she was ashamed of what she had done and did not believe in abortion.
